What are some popular summer beach art ideas? Let’s dive in!

  • Sand Sculptures: Transform the beach into your personal art studio with intricate sandcastle designs, whimsical mermaid figures, or abstract sand art.
  • Seashell Crafts: Gather seashells of all shapes and sizes to create unique jewelry, decorative ornaments, or even miniature beach scenes.
  • Driftwood Art: Turn weathered pieces of driftwood into stunning sculptures, wall hangings, or even functional art pieces like picture frames or jewelry stands.
  • Beach Paintings: Capture the breathtaking beauty of the coastline with vibrant watercolor paintings, acrylic seascapes, or even oil paintings on canvas.
  • Photography: Document the mesmerizing play of light and shadow on the beach, the crashing waves, and the colorful beach umbrellas through stunning photography.

What Materials Do I Need for Summer Beach Art?

The materials you’ll need depend on the type of art you want to create. For sand sculptures, all you need are sand, water, and some basic tools like buckets and shovels. For seashell crafts, you’ll need shells, glue, and any additional decorative elements you’d like to incorporate. Driftwood art requires driftwood, tools for cutting and shaping the wood, and paint or varnish if desired. For painting and photography, you’ll need your chosen art supplies and camera equipment.
